The expense of a personal ADHD diagnosis in the UK can vary considerably, depending upon several factors including the center, location, and the level of the assessments carried out. Below is a table that sums up typical expenses associated with personal ADHD diagnosis.
ServiceApproximated Cost (₤)Initial Consultation₤ 150 - ₤ 300Comprehensive Assessment₤ 400 - ₤ 1,000ADHD Rating Scales₤ 50 - ₤ 150Follow-Up Appointments₤ 100 - ₤ 200Medication Review₤ 100 - ₤ 250Total Treatment Plan₤ 200 - ₤ 500Overall Estimated Cost for Diagnosis₤ 400 - ₤ 2,500Breakdown of Costs
Initial Consultation: The first appointment usually includes discussing signs, case history, and possible ADHD evaluations. Expenses may vary in between ₤ 150 and ₤ 300.
Comprehensive Assessment: This consists of comprehensive assessments, interviews, and standardized screening by a psychiatrist or psychologist. Depending upon the clinic, this can be in the variety of ₤ 400 to ₤ 1,000.

Follow-Up Appointments: After the preliminary evaluation, ongoing follow-up visits for tracking and support can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 200.
Medication Review: If medication is suggested, examining its effectiveness will cost around ₤ 100 to ₤ 250.

Total Cost for Diagnosis
The overall estimated expense for a total personal ADHD diagnosis in the UK can fall anywhere from ₤ 400 to ₤ 2,500, depending on specific treatment strategies and the particular services needed.
Aspects Influencing Cost
Numerous factors can affect the general cost of a personal ADHD diagnosis:
Location: Costs may be greater in significant cities such as London compared to smaller towns.Center Reputation: Established clinics or those with specialized professionals may charge more.Type of Specialists: Psychiatrists might charge more than psychologists for similar services.Level of Assessments: Some evaluations may need extra tests or assessments, increasing the cost.Often Asked Questions

3. For how long does the assessment process take?
The evaluation procedure can differ. A preliminary assessment may last 1 to 2 hours, while detailed assessments can take a number of hours or may be spread over numerous sessions.
4. What qualifications should the evaluating professional have?
It's suggested to seek professionals who are Chartered Clinical Psychologists, Psychiatrists, or other psychological health specialists with experience in ADHD.
5. Will I be recommended medication after diagnosis?
A personal assessment may lead to recommendations for medication, treatment, or a mix of treatments. The decision will depend upon private needs and signs.
